Hikers, mountain bikers and surfers delight in a stay on the edge of the Snowdonia National Park, within easy reach of the coast and fantastic forest and woodlands. This handsome country cottage has been thoughtfully renovated in a historic farmhouse, happily hosting five guests in perfect family-friendly surroundings. Elegant décor and modern design features are laid out throughout, neatly blended into stone walls and ancient beams to create an utterly appealing environment on both storeys. Spend your days exploring the countryside on foot or two wheels and your nights admiring the view from the fabulous garden.

You’ll need to walk through this garden, an enclosed space with outdoor furniture, to reach the property’s front door. Once inside, a spacious hallway leads to a kitchen/diner and a lovely lounge with plush sofas and a Smart TV. An additional Smart TV in the dining space allows you to enjoy the morning’s news or some music over breakfast. Notice a ground-floor bathroom on your way to the first floor. Upstairs, three beautifully presented bedrooms are laid out around a second bathroom, this one with its own bathtub that’s a dream to soak in at the end of an outdoor adventure-packed afternoon.

The wide stretch of sands at Morfa Dyffryn Beach is just 4.5 miles away, easily accessible by footpath or car as required. A place for swimming, sunbathing and ball games, this vast beach sits on Cardigan Bay with views across the Llyn Peninsula and tranquil turquoise waters. Keen surfers will love to visit Barmouth Beach (6 miles), accessible along the Wales Coast Path. Moving inland, get to know Snowdonia with a trip to the Coed y Brenin Forest Park (approx. 20 miles), a destination for mountain biking, mystical woodland walks and those seeking verdant wildlife.
